Cuisinart Chef’s Classic Stainless Universal Double Boiler with Cover
- Universal double boiler made of professional-quality 18/10 stainless steel
- Solid stainless-steel riveted handle stays cool on stovetop; generous handle on cover
- Tight-fitting lid seals in flavors and nutrients; tapered rim ensures drip-free pouring
- Dishwasher safe; oven safe to 550 degrees F; fits 2-, 3- and 4-quart saucepans
- Measures approximately 8 by 3 inches; limited lifetime warranty

How To Be Greener Today for Tomorrow

★When it comes to sustainable living and to have an effect to the issue of global warming, every little thing that does not count. Here are some suggestions for changes, small and simple things you can do in your kitchen that will help reduce their energy consumption and reduce their environmental footprint. We do not fill the kettle with as much water as you want. More water is boiled, the more power is needed and where that water will not be used, which has lost energy is needed. Remember that water escapes as steam, so if you want a cup of tea, just add a cup and a tablespoon or more. 2.
